How can frontline employees ensure that their feedback is being taken seriously and acted upon by upper management in order to drive meaningful change within the organization?
Frontline employees can ensure that their feedback is taken seriously by providing specific and actionable suggestions for improvement, highlighting the impact of their feedback on customer experience or operational efficiency. They can also collaborate with their peers to gather collective feedback and present a unified front to upper management. Additionally, they should follow up on their feedback to track progress and demonstrate their commitment to driving positive change within the organization.
